Drop-off: The first bell will ring at 7:55 a.m., and school will begin at 8:00 a.m. Gates will open at 7:40 a.m. each morning and close at 8:00 a.m. Students will be marked tardy at 8:01 a.m. We will have three gates open in the morning: TK/Kindergarten, the front gate, and the bus loop gate closest to the front of the school.


If you are dropping off your student in the morning and not getting out of your car, you may use the front parking lot; the bus loop gate will be for staff parking and bus drop-off only.  If you are walking your child up to the classroom or gate, please park on the neighborhood streets or the front parking lot to walk your child in.   We will have crossing guards at the intersections of Schoolhouse Circle and Lenox Ct. and Schoolhouse Circle and River Oaks Drive.

School Supplies: All necessary school supplies will be provided for your children. It is helpful if your child brings a backpack, a lunch pail if they choose to bring a home lunch, and a water bottle to school. Many primary teachers have a lunch wagon and a snack bucket. Students typically arrive at school, hang up their backpacks, place their lunch in the wagon, and place their snack in the snack bin if they have one.

Breakfast and Lunch: All students will have the option of a school breakfast and lunch.  Menus will be posted within our Weekly Updates.

Dismissal: Each grade level will be released from the gate closest to its classroom. After the 2:25 dismissal, families may enter campus through the gates to check in with teachers or visit the library (when it opens in a few weeks).

Parent Volunteers: Volunteers must complete a Volunteer Packet each year; new volunteers must be fingerprinted for field trips. The fingerprinting process will take a few weeks. Once you complete the fingerprint process, you will not have to repeat it.  


If you plan to volunteer and/or accompany your student on field trips, I encourage you to complete the process now so you are cleared. Please contact our office for the volunteer packet and details.

Attendance Notifications - EDIA: Starting this year, PRJUSD will be using a program called EDIA for attendance messaging. When your student is absent, you will get a text message from EDIA asking you why your student is out (If you didn't call in before). You can simply text back, and the program will correct the attendance in Aeries. 


Just a reminder, you have 72 hours to clear an absence, or your student will be marked as truant.


Student Pick Up: When picking up your student from the main office, please follow these guidelines:

  • All authorized pick-up persons must be listed in Aeries in advance. Only individuals on the student's authorized contact list who are 18 years or older will be permitted to pick up students.

  • Parents: Always bring a valid photo ID when checking out your student.

  • If someone other than a parent is picking up the student:

    • Ensure they are already listed in Aeries before they arrive.

    • The parent must provide written authorization (text message, email, or physical note) to the office.

    • The designated person must bring their valid photo ID.
